Auto merge of #73276 - Dylan-DPC:rollup-hfd81qw, r=Dylan-DPC
Rollup of 5 pull requests

Successful merges:

 - #72906 (Migrate to numeric associated consts)
 - #73178 (expand: More precise locations for expansion-time lints)
 - #73225 (Allow inference regions when relating consts)
 - #73236 (Clean up E0666 explanation)
 - #73273 (Fix Zulip pings)
